Production technology

If you are seriously thinking about organizing the cultivation of these unusual birds, be sure to get a good quail breeding manual.

The first thing to start with is the arrangement of a room for keeping birds. Large areas at the first stage are not required, it is recommended to start with the number of no more than 500 birds.

When the place is prepared, you can start buying feed and young animals. Quails are fed with compound feed and a mixture of corn, wheat, barley, etc. Vitamins (shell rock, chalk) must be added to the diet.

The mini-farm should contain a parent flock (3-4 hens per male). The livestock must be periodically updated, since one-year-old birds have half the productivity.

To breed young, quail eggs are needed no older than three months, so products from older females are used only for food. Annual birds are most often slaughtered for meat.

"Birdyard" today and tomorrow

Alexey Dzhalilovich Bekirov was born in Kyrgyzstan. Then he moved with his family to the Crimea, from where he joined the army. Returning home after demobilization and finding devastation and unemployment around, he went to Moscow to army friends. And as he himself admits, wherever he worked, he even had to sell jeans ... Alexei has no special agricultural education yet, at one time he studied to be a manager. “But apparently, somewhere in my genes it is written to work on the land,” the farmer says.

I started my business by taking a loan from a bank and buying an abandoned, dilapidated farm in the Vladimir region, Bekirov recalls, - only 4.5 hectares of land and buildings on it - a pigsty, a cowshed, a feed shop, a warehouse ... Since my farm is located on the territory of the Petushinsky district, I decided to call it "Bird's Yard". In addition to the land that I now own, the local administration allocated another 70 hectares to me for rent so that I could make hay.

First of all, I bought horses, and for this I went to Tatarstan, to a "wild" village, to an ecologically clean area, where the animals were definitely healthy. Almost immediately, he also started cows so that there would be something to feed the workers (they always have fresh milk and cottage cheese). From there, from Tatarstan, he brought a hundred rams. The first year they successfully "cut" the grass on the farm. But as practice has shown, it is not profitable to keep sheep in our area - they feel good where there is grazing all year round. So small cattle were abandoned, but quails appeared on the farm instead.

This bird does not need large areas. The cowshed was converted into a sparrowhawk. We cleaned the room, put the cages and launched the bird. The climate in our area is suitable for quails - not very hot and not too cold, you do not need to spend a lot of energy on heating. Birds have a body temperature of 42 °, and the optimum temperature in the room is 20-25 °, so quails partially heat themselves. Now on my farm, the breeding herd of quails has 35 thousand heads. The room where they are kept is designed for 200 thousand heads, but it makes no sense to increase the number of livestock - there is no corresponding market. Today I can a short time"accelerate" to the production of 150 thousand eggs per day, but there are no reliable distribution channels for such a quantity of products.

Quail I keep Estonian and Japanese (egg). I select the best birds in the parent flock. There is even a “stud book”, more precisely, a journal where all information about quails is entered from the incubator to the slaughter. It seems to me that without this it is simply impossible to conduct business effectively.

In the beginning, old Samsung refrigerators were converted into incubators, and now the farm has industrial incubators designed for 3,000 chicken eggs; about 15,000 quail eggs can be incubated in them at the same time. In a month we can bring out up to 100 thousand quails. They hatch after 17 days of incubation. Then we transplant them into brooders (I call them nurseries). The chicks stay there until the age of three weeks, the temperature in the brooders is gradually reduced from 38° to 20°. At the age of 3 weeks, we sort the quail by gender. We fatten the males for meat (or they go to repair the herd), and let the females to produce eggs. We move them to the common room. Now the farm produces about 8 thousand eggs per day. This number is difficult, but divergent in the markets.

We feed an adult bird twice a day: in the morning - at 7 o'clock, and at the same time we turn on the light in the room; the second time - in the evening, at 8 o'clock, 2 hours after that, turn off the light. Such a system is optimal for achieving high egg production in laying hens. Light day in a bird lasts 9-10 hours. Feed is a balanced feed for quails. It is prepared for us at the feed mill by special order. Moreover, for males that are grown for meat, and for laying hens, feed is prepared according to different recipes.

For the first three days, quails eat a mixture of boiled quail eggs and cottage cheese (we prepare it from milk from our cows). Receiving such food, quail grow well, do not get sick. I believe that from the first days the bird should be fed as best as possible - after all, this is the key to its entire future life and productivity. Then the quails are transferred to the starter feed, and only then, when transferred to the common room, we accustom the young to the feed for an adult bird.

P.S. Bekirov's farm not only produces agricultural products, but also manufactures equipment. When the question arose about equipping the sparrowhawk, it was possible to solve it in two ways: to purchase domestic equipment or to buy foreign equipment. Domestic for the industrial maintenance of quails cost about 150 thousand rubles, and foreign (for 100 thousand heads) and even more - 300 thousand euros. And Alexey Dzhalilovich decided to make cells on his own. I bought a grid with the desired cell, made cells with my own hands. They cost the farmer 5 times cheaper than purchased ones. Then he acquired Italian equipment for automatic watering of poultry. The experience gained allowed us to organize the manufacture of equipment for keeping quails (from small livestock to industrial ones).

For example, a mini-farm for a city apartment. By installing this on the balcony, you can keep several birds in it and get 4-5 fresh quail eggs daily. Quails do not eat much - 35-40 g of feed per laying hen is enough. Litter is collected in a plastic bucket with a lid, this saves the owners from an unpleasant smell.

The farm produces mini-farms in another version - for summer residents. The cage is designed for 50 heads. Such a mini-farm will give eggs, carcasses, and valuable fertilizer - litter. I repeat: the bird does not eat so much food, it is resistant to diseases, it does not need walking, it requires little space. Such a mini-farm can be installed under a canopy, the main thing is that there are no drafts and the roof protects from rain and from the sun. This option is also suitable for small businesses. QUAIL MINI FARM

Purpose: Creation and development of a quail mini-farm to meet the demand of your region for quail eggs and meat.

Required premises:

The premises should be well ventilated, with the ability to maintain the temperature required for quails at 18-20 degrees.

1. Room for the parent herd (150 heads: 100 females + 50 roosters) + egg-laying herd (200 females) - 4 sq.m.

2. Hatchery + room for rearing young animals (3000 pcs.) - 10-12 sq.m.

3. Slaughter shop, cooling - any free room (kitchen)

Required equipment:

1. Cage for maternal herd for 150 quails.

In self-manufacturing, the cost of materials (mesh, pipe, drinkers, galvanized iron) 4-7

The cost for custom-made is 15-20 thousand rubles.

2. Cage for an egg flock for 200 quails

With self-production, the cost of materials (mesh, pipe, drinking bowls, galvanized iron) is 5-7 thousand rubles

The cost for custom-made is 18-30 thousand rubles.

3. Brooder (2 pieces of 4-5 tiers) size 0.6 * 0.9 m.

With self-production, the cost of materials is 5-9 thousand rubles for 2 pcs. Custom cost 2 pcs. 20-30 thousand rubles per piece

4. Growing cage 3 pcs.

With self-production, the cost of materials is 4-7 thousand rubles

Cost for custom made 3 pcs. 15-20 thousand rubles each a piece.

5. Farm incubator (Blitz, TGB and the like)

3 pieces for 10-15 thousand rubles

Attention! inexpensive household foam incubators are not very suitable for quail hatching.

Description of the production process

The mother flock, consisting of 100-120 females and 30-50 males, depending on the breed, is intended for obtaining hatching eggs. When breeding for meat, we recommend using Texas quail. A flock in this quantity should lay 400-450 eggs of incubation quality per week. Rejected eggs are sold as food.

The eggs laid in the first week are laid in the incubator. Eggs laid in the second week are laid in the second incubator. Eggs laid in the third week are laid in the third incubator.

In the middle of the third week (on the 16-17th day), the quail hatches in the first incubator. Of 450 eggs, 350-400 quails should hatch, of which at least 300 heads should survive to adulthood.

Newborn quails are placed in the first brooder until the age of 10 days.

In the middle of the fourth week after the start of activity, the quail hatches in the second incubator, which are placed in the second brooder.

By the time of hatching, the first brooder is released in the third incubator, the grown chicks from which are transferred to the cage for rearing. This continues every week: eggs are collected, laid in incubators, chicks in a brooder, then in cages for rearing.

On days 42-56 (depending on condition), the first batch of quails is sent for slaughter.

Accordingly, after 2.5 months we have the first results for meat. At least 220 quail carcasses are subject to sale. The remaining amount can be used as replacement young for old or departed parents; partially implemented.

About money

TOTAL for the second half of the 3rd month of work, you can sell 440

500 carcasses. The wholesale price of the carcass is 100 rubles. The revenue will be 44-50 thousand rubles. On

The 4th month you reach full volumes and sell 880-1000 carcasses, receiving revenue of 88-100 thousand rubles.

At the same time, over your well-being, tirelessly working

egg flock. A herd of 200 females will lay 160-170 eggs per day. During the week

1120-1190 eggs. Considering your own consumption, let's say you sell 1000 eggs per week. The minimum price of a food egg is 3-4 rubles. Accordingly, your monthly revenue is 12-16 thousand rubles.

TOTAL in general, you get 100-116 thousand rubles. revenue monthly.

Expenses - in the first place food. Mother flock + egg flock (total 350 heads) consumes 350 kg of feed per month. Feed cost is excellent different regions, you can make it yourself or buy a factory one. On average, the cost varies from 15 to 30 rubles. per kg. Accordingly, adult birds will eat 5250-10500 rubles from your proceeds. Young animals will eat about 1.1 kg before slaughter. stern

Accordingly, 1000 pcs. per month they will eat 16,500 - 33,000 rubles. at the same time, the birds will produce about 1 ton of highly valuable environmentally friendly natural fertilizer per month. Which, when packed in bags, can bring another 2 - 3 thousand rubles.

It should be borne in mind that, as usual, any culinary actions with carcasses greatly increase revenue, and, as a result, profit. For example, smoking quails in the presence of a simple smokehouse increases the cost by at least 2 times. Also, do not forget about the delicious expensive quail giblets (liver, heart), the cost is 500-800 rubles. per kg. In any case, paying attention to the market of your region and conducting a small survey, you will understand what your customers need first of all.

So, with an average revenue of 100 thousand rubles, feed costs on average 33 thousand rubles. +7 thousand rubles for various planned and unplanned expenses, at a minimum you have 60 thousand rubles of net profit.
